Wormholes without exotic matter in nonminimal torsion-matter coupling $f(T)$ gravity
Nonminimal torsion-matter coupling in f(T) gravity permits wormholes threaded by nonexotic matter near the throat, yet geometric constraints force finite size and prevent extension across all spacetime.

Transiently accelerating cosmological model with Gong-Zhang parametrization in $f(T)$ teleparallel gravity
In f(T) gravity with Gong-Zhang EoS parametrization, the fitted model shows transient acceleration followed by future deceleration and satisfies thermodynamic consistency.
